The major key business process for Eureka Limited is the production and supply of
beverages, which can help in generating high level of income from operations. The company has
been generating high level of income by producing the beverages, which is sold from different
business, supermarkets and pub-chains. In addition, the organisation directly aims in producing
higher level of beverages, where continuous improvement in the current beverage conditions has
been conducted to support the demand from the customers. The company has witnessed mixed
fortunes over the years in terms of business, which has helped in improving the level of income
from operations and producing new beverages to the customers. The organisation has mainly
aimed in producing new products, which can help in generating high level of income from
operations. The continuous development of the new beverage product has been conducted by the
organisation, which has helped in maximising the level of products that could be provided that
period of time. The beverage of the company has been producing healthy drinks, which ware
currently in high demand from customers (Rainer, Prince and Watson 2014).
